I found a folder on my computer called "tumblr sucks" which must have been photos I wanted to upload to Tumblr right around the time they changed their policy to disallow nudity around 2018. My Tumblr was so much fun cause it was all my 35mm chaos, but obviously there was ton of NSFW content, especially around this time because I had been working on my nude instant film book Instaxxx for much of 2017. I wrote an article for Boing Boing about how this decision was going to destroy Tumblr and wrote a bit about the FOSTA/SESTA bill that was meant to "protect children" but really just became a way to censor the internet and here we are less than a decade later and even artistic nudity has been pushed to the back rooms of the internet and while Tumblr is still holding on, it's a shadow of its former self. https://boingboing.net/2018/12/03/the-death-of-tumblr.html
